Summary of Job Description:

The Manager, DevOps Automation is responsible for the strategy, delivery, and ongoing maturity of Panda Restaurant Group’s infrastructure automation and Infrastructure as Code (IaC) capabilities. This position leads a team of DevOps Automation Engineers while serving as a hands‑on technical leader, ensuring enterprise infrastructure platforms are scalable, reliable, secure, and operationally efficient. The Manager, DevOps Automation partners closely with Infrastructure, Cloud, Security, Application, and Operations teams to enable standardized automation across on‑premises, cloud, and hybrid environments. With a strong emphasis on automation tools, orchestration platforms, and automation governance, this position reduces operational toil, accelerates delivery, and improves platform stability. In addition, the Manager provides leadership and oversight for Active Directory and Microsoft 365 (O365) automation and operational excellence, ensuring identity and productivity platforms remain secure and resilient at enterprise scale.


You’ll get a chance to:

  • Leads the design, implementation, and governance of enterprise DevOps automation and Infrastructure as Code (IaC) solutions across data center, cloud, and hybrid environments.
  • Manages a team of DevOps Automation Engineers, coaching and developing associates to elevate their performance and for long‑term growth and succession. Works with leadership to recruit, select, and retain team members.
  • Serves as the primary technical authority for Ansible, including playbook design, role development, collections, and orchestration workflows.
  • Responsible for the platform strategy, configuration, and operational governance of Ansible Tower / AWX, ensuring secure access, reliable execution, and standardized usage.
  • Establishes reusable automation patterns for infrastructure provisioning, configuration management, patching, compliance, and lifecycle management.
  • Partners with Cloud, Infrastructure, and Security teams to embed automation into CI/CD pipelines, change workflows, and operational processes.
  • Provides leadership and oversight for Active Directory (on‑prem and hybrid) and Microsoft 365 (O365) automation, operational hygiene, and platform stability.
  • Ensures identity and productivity platforms meet enterprise security, compliance, and governance requirements.
  • Defines and tracks KPIs related to automation coverage, reliability, operational efficiency, and risk reduction.
  • Drives operational excellence by reducing manual intervention, improving repeatability, and increasing auditability across infrastructure platforms.
  • Evaluates new tools and technologies to improve automation maturity, standardization, and developer enablement.
  • Produces and maintains documentation, standards, and reference architectures to enable consistent execution across teams.
